So we have to rebuild this format from the on-disk directory list. > + for (i = 0; i < subtree_nr; i++) { > + struct cache_tree *sub; > + struct cache_tree_sub *subtree; > + char *buf, *name; > + > + name = ""; > + buf = strtok(down[i].de->pathname, "/"); man 3 strtok says Be cautious when using these functions. If you do use them, note that: * These functions modify their first argument. * These functions cannot be used on constant strings. * The identity of the delimiting character is lost. * The strtok() function uses a static buffer while parsing, so it's not thread safe. Use strtok_r() if this matters to you. I don't think the last point will be a problem, but what about modifying the argument? -- Thomas Rast trast@{inf,student}.ethz.ch
